So, 'Cat Call' is this quirky comedy-romance that hits a sweet spot, you know? The premise is pretty wildâa thirty-something gal, disillusioned with love, suddenly befriends a talking black cat. Only she can hear it, which adds this whimsical twist. The pacing is a bit offbeat, which some might find charming, as it mirrors the protagonist's own meandering journey through loneliness and self-discovery. The atmosphere carries a light-hearted tone, but it doesn't shy away from exploring deeper themes of connection and hope. Practical effects are minimal but effective, leaning heavily on the performances. The cat, voiced with just the right amount of sass, steals the scenes. It's a blend of silly and poignant, which makes it stand out.
